How to find the frequency resolution of an fft? The frequency resolution is equal to the sampling frequency divided by FFT size. For example, an FFT of size 256 of a signal sampled at 8000Hz will have a frequency resolution of 31.25Hz. If the signal is a sine wave of 110 Hz, the ideal FFT would show a sharp peak at 110Hz.

How higher magnification affect resolution?
Resolution is a somewhat subjective value in optical microscopy because at high magnification, an image may appear unsharp but still be resolved to the maximum ability of the objective. The higher the numerical aperture of the total system, the better the resolution.

What the resolution for the amazon website?
Amazon Product images must be at least 1000 pixels on its longest side and 500 pixels on its shortest side. The product must fill at least 85% of the image, meaning that white space should only take up 15% of the entire image. Images are required to have a resolution minimum of 72 dpi.

What was the resolution of the connecticut compromise?
The Connecticut Compromise, or Great Compromise, reconciled the two sides by making up one house of the legislature, the Senate, of two equal representatives from each state, and the other house of legislature, the House of Representatives, to be distributed according to the population of each state.

What is cif resolution for recording?
CIF CCTV resolution is 352 x 240 pixels in size and is one quarter the resolution of D1. This resolution is typically used by mid level stand alone DVR recorders when recording real time video.

Why were the kentucky and virginia resolutions significance?
The resolutions argued that the states had the right and the duty to declare unconstitutional those acts of Congress that the Constitution did not authorize. In doing so, they argued for states’ rights and strict construction of the Constitution.

How to change video resolution in adobe premiere pro?
In the “Editing” workspace, go to the “Project Panel“. Right-click on the sequence that needs to be updated and select “Sequence Settings”. “Sequence Settings” window will be displayed. Against “Frame Size“, change the “horizontal” and “vertical” resolution to, say, 1920 and 1080 for a 1080p HD project.
